Following the stock market can drive you crazy if you take it too seriously. We are called to be good stewards of all the blessings God has bestowed upon us. And being a good steward means handling our time, talent and treasure in a God honoring way and it also means putting our material wealth into the proper perspective.
Know what is happening in the stock market, but don’t obsess over it. Realize that God owns everything and he is in control—not you!
